Redis 錯誤1067:進程意外終止,Redis不能啟動,Redis啟動不了


Redis 錯誤1067:進程意外終止,Redis不能啟動,Redis啟動不了

 

>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>

©Copyright 蕃薯耀 2017年7月17日

http://www.cnblogs.com/fanshuyao/

 

一、問題描述:

在Windows啟動Redis服務時,發生如下錯誤:

Java代碼   收藏代碼
  1. Windows無法啟動Redis服務(位於本地計算機上)。  
  2. 錯誤1067:進程意外終止。  

 


 

 

在Windows CMD命令行啟動時提示:

 

Java代碼   收藏代碼
  1. D:\soft\Redis>redis-server.exe redis.windows.conf  
  2. [9560] 15 Jul 10:33:32.364 # Creating Server TCP listening socket 192.168.100.666:6379: 不知道這樣的主機。  

 

 

二、解決方案:

產生這個問題(Redis服務無法啟動)的原因是因為在配置文件(redis.windows.conf)中綁定了局域網的地址,就如下:

Java代碼   收藏代碼
  1. bind 127.0.0.1 192.168.1.666  

 但綁定的ip地址找不到,所以導致報錯,Redis服務不能啟動。

 

其實Redis裝在本機,127.0.0.1是可以的,但局域網的ip(192.168.100.666)由於電腦重啟會重新獲取ip,導致ip發生變化,此時再啟動Redis時,就找不到原來的局域網ip地址,造成Redis無法啟動。

 

解決方法就是把不固定的ip地址(192.168.100.666)刪除掉,保留127.0.0.1,再啟動就沒有問題。

 

(如果你覺得文章對你有幫助,歡迎捐贈,^_^,謝謝!) 

 >>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>

©Copyright 蕃薯耀 2017年7月17日

http://www.cnblogs.com/fanshuyao/


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M